Output d6112810ec35bafb74e175883e0858aac0bbe507aa79bc22e740288338b71c1f:1

value
5349305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b12bf8ee503756917e07967f9967e43faf89de4 OP_EQUAL
address
34AAdNmTHHhuiCFf8zkUogX5jmuMqVBwRi
transaction
d6112810ec35bafb74e175883e0858aac0bbe507aa79bc22e740288338b71c1f
confirmations
177704
spent
true